摘要
Agriculture and its allied sectors have been generating a huge amount of big data. This data includes the different forms such as structured, semi-structured and unstructured real time data. This has led to impose challenges to mine knowledge. Data Mining has left a vast scope for decision making in government and enterprises. The gap has been bridged by several techniques. Data mining is one of the such technique. The recent advanced information technology techniques such as spatial information technology has the capability of analyzing the wider range of agriculture related resources. The different agriculture related parameters include soil, climatic conditions, irrigation and water availability pattern and various socio-economic variables. The paper aims to systematically review the current researches on geospatial information for making better decisions in agriculture. The study also summarizes the application of geospatial data mining techniques and algorithms in agriculture. The study is an initiative in the current era for building a decision support system in agriculture sector. © 2022. School of Science, IHU. All rights reserved.
